Output dfafdfcdbad4b95f33c3a5e34c703c809ffbc093ceb54ffaec1f2a73fc066050:2

value
320301
script pubkey
OP_0 OP_PUSHBYTES_20 8bd34a5d4e6ab0a4e48ef4f9e92a4278163dfc23
address
bc1q30f55h2wd2c2feyw7nu7j2jz0qtrmlpr5rnr95
transaction
dfafdfcdbad4b95f33c3a5e34c703c809ffbc093ceb54ffaec1f2a73fc066050
confirmations
65135
spent
true